Output 63eecba13580aaac5ebfdb61a144ad7e089f2a5030db750b39169e319e7860b2:0

value
1427114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68c763fc1d52d0f920c53fda94f9f04f796b888b OP_EQUAL
address
3BF34PmyuTrVbB7bhEE2skrCu3p4josLhx
transaction
63eecba13580aaac5ebfdb61a144ad7e089f2a5030db750b39169e319e7860b2
spent
true